Course name: Nontheatrical Formats & Operations. 35mm, VHS, and smartphone digital video—each format presents its own advantages to production, aesthetic specificity, as well as exhibition and circulation.
This course shifts methodological attention toward the technological particularities of audiovisual formats. How did emerging media formats mobilize the production of specific categories of non-fiction, such as ethnographic film and propaganda?
This course covers the major texts in recent debates surrounding “format” in nontheatrical film and media studies.
Learn theoretical frameworks and examine historical literature and primary texts illustrative of three distinct “formats”: 16mm film, VHS video, and codecs for digital compression. The focus of this class is non-fiction, nontheatrical film and media.
Accordingly, questions regarding the format of a particular example of film or media will be considered alongside their “use,” “utility,” or “operation” by studying aspects of distribution, exhibition, and material circulation. Students will produce written formal, historical, or theoretical analyses of film and media texts that consider the history of nontheatrical film and media in relation to the specificity of technological format.
